What is Hard Water?
Hard water is identified by its mineral content, especially cal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als get in the water supply as it percolates with limestone and chalk deposits underground. When difficult water is warmed or left to stand, it often tends to form range, a crusty build-up that follows surface areas and can cause a series of problems in pipes systems.

Water Conditioners
Water softeners are the most common remedy for dealing with difficult water. They work by trading cal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, efficiently lowering the solidity of the water.
Various Other Treatment Alternatives
Along with water softeners, other therapy choices consist of mag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ical ingredients. Each approach has its advantages and viability depending upon the seriousness of the tough water issue and household requirements.

Understanding Hard Water. Hard water contains high levels of minerals, particularly calcium and magnesium, which are naturally present in the water supply. When hard water flows through your plumbing system, these minerals can accumulate over time, causing various issues. This mineral buildup, known as scale, can clog pipes, reduce water flow, and impair the efficiency of plumbing fixtures and appliances. Recognizing the Signs of Hard Water. To determine if you have hard water, there are several signs to look out for. These include soap scum residue on surfaces, stained fixtures, reduced water flow, and increased energy bills.
